Spend Your Summer with the American Anthropological Association

The American Anthropological Association is pleased to offer two internship opportunities!

Internships are six weeks in length during the summer of 2015. While the internships are unpaid, interns will be provided with housing and a meal/travel stipend. Interns will spend approximately 40 percent of their time working onsite at the AAA offices in Arlington, VA with the other 60 percent of their time working onsite at one of two locations: Washington's historical Navy Yard or The National Museum of African Art.

Eligibility:
Undergraduate students in their junior or senior year
First Year Graduate students (completing the first year of graduate work by June 2014)


AAA activities are to include:
  • Assisting in the planning for the RACE: Are We So Different? press viewing for its opening at the Smithsonian Museum of Natural History
  • Researching membership trends in the AAA 
  • Developing and drafting materials for the AAA bi-weekly podcasts
  • Drafting text for Anthropology News (AN) newsletter articles 
  • Other activities as assigned


Call for Applications Opens: February 6, 2015
Application Deadline: March 15, 2015
